Understanding Inclusion Strategies

Inclusion strategies are planned approaches designed to break down barriers and empower people ‌of ​all backgrounds to participate fully. Successful inclusion strategies often address cultural,⁤ physical, and cognitive differences, ⁤ensuring ⁢that every individual feels valued and supported. Modern ⁢organizations ⁣use proven approaches such as inclusive leadership,employee resource‌ groups,and accessible facilities to drive meaningful change.

  • Promoting diverse representation
  • Implementing accessible technologies
  • Adopting flexible policies
  • Fostering open dialogue and feedback

Case Study 1: Google’s “Project Aristotle” – inclusive Team Communication

Background: Google⁣ sought⁣ to understand what makes teams successful. ‍Through “Project aristotle,” Google found that psychological safety and ‌inclusive team behaviors were key factors.

  • Encouraged open, honest​ communication
  • Created frameworks for respectful⁢ disagreement
  • Recognized diverse contributions

Result: Teams with high psychological safety and inclusion ‌were more productive, creative, and satisfied.

Case Study ​2:​ Microsoft⁢ – Accessibility as ⁢an Inclusion Strategy

Background: Microsoft set out ‌to become the most accessible technology company in the world.Through focused initiatives, they designed products and services with inclusivity at thier core.

  • invested in adaptive technologies (e.g. screen reader,eye-control systems)
  • Established ⁣accessibility standards⁣ across all products
  • Provided employee training on inclusion ⁤and accessibility

Result: Microsoft products ‌now⁢ empower people of⁣ all‌ abilities,setting a global standard for inclusion.

Case Study 3: Boston Public Schools – Inclusive Education Programs

Background: Boston ⁢Public Schools ⁢(BPS) launched a district-wide initiative to integrate students with disabilities into mainstream classrooms.

  • Utilized Global Design for Learning (UDL)
  • Trained teachers on adaptive practices
  • Established‍ peer mentoring programs

Result: Higher academic outcomes and improved social-emotional well-being in inclusive classrooms.

Practical Tips for Implementing Successful inclusion Strategies

Expert-Recommended Tips for Lasting Inclusion

  • Assess your current habitat: Conduct surveys and focus groups⁣ to identify‌ gaps in inclusion.
  • engage stakeholders: Empower employees, students, or community⁣ members to lead inclusion initiatives.
  • Promote ⁣ongoing training: Invest ‍in professional growth⁢ on diversity,equity,and​ inclusion.
  • Measure progress: Set⁣ clear goals and use⁢ data-driven metrics to evaluate inclusivity.
  • Leverage technology: Harness accessible‍ tools ‌and platforms to support all abilities.
  • Foster inclusive⁢ leadership: Ensure leaders model ‌inclusive behaviors and champion diverse perspectives.

Challenges ‍and How to⁢ Overcome​ them

Even the best inclusion strategies face challenges. Here’s how to address common ‍obstacles:

  • Resistance to‍ change: Use change management techniques and share case study evidence to build buy-in.
  • Unconscious bias: Incorporate ⁤regular bias training and facilitate open discussions.
  • Resource limitations: Prioritize high-impact actions and seek partnerships for⁣ additional support.
  • Measuring success: Integrate inclusivity metrics into established performance frameworks.
